Masks
The Government of Manitoba has mandated the use of non-medical masks in all schools. As per the provincial directive, all students in Grades 4-12, and all staff and visitors are required to wear non-medical masks where 2-metre physical distancing is not possible. Bus drivers and all school bus passengers in Grades 4-12 are required to wear non-medical masks on the bus. Parents/Guardians will continue to choose whether students in Grades K-3 should wear a mask.

We understand that for some parents/guardians, the mask requirements are a concern. We respect the diversity of opinion and value your constructive feedback; however, Hanover School Division must follow safety protocols set forth by Manitoba Education and the Chief Provincial Public Health Officer. Mask requirements in schools are provincially mandated. The EngageMB website remains the best forum for parents/guardians, caregivers, and students to post questions and give feedback.
